Little Union Gorge Falls Waterfall in Carp Lake Township, Michigan

Little Union Gorge Falls in Carp Lake Township, Michigan, offers a unique and exciting adventure for those who visit. The highlight of the experience is walking up the river, directly in the water, which adds an element of fun and challenge to the hike. The waterfall itself is described as cool, making it a rewarding sight after the trek. Overall, it provides a memorable outing for anyone looking to explore nature in a more interactive way.
